THREE-DIMENSIONAL STRUCTURE OF THE TETRAGONAL CRYSTAL FORM OF EGG-WHITE AVIDIN IN ITS FUNCTIONAL COMPLEX WITH BIOTIN AT 2.7 ANGSTROMS RESOLUTION

About this Structure

1AVD is a 2 chains structure of sequences from Gallus gallus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
